mysql修改索引语句
时间: 2023-10-01 14:04:55 浏览: 78
要修改 MySQL 中的索引,可以使用 ALTER TABLE 语句。具体步骤如下:
1. 打开 MySQL 命令行或者 MySQL 客户端。
2. 进入需要修改的数据库。
```
use database_name;
```
3. 查看当前表的索引。
```
show index from table_name;
```
4. 根据需要修改索引。
```
ALTER TABLE table_name DROP INDEX index_name;
ALTER TABLE table_name ADD INDEX index_name (column_name);
```
上述语句中,DROP INDEX 用于删除指定的索引,ADD INDEX 用于添加新索引。
5. 再次查看当前表的索引,确认修改成功。
```
show index from table_name;
```
注意事项:
- 修改索引可能会影响数据库性能,建议在非高峰期进行操作。
- 修改索引时,要确保语句正确,避免误删或者误操作。
相关问题
mysql 修改索引的语句
要修改MySQL中的索引,你可以使用`ALTER TABLE`语句来添加、删除或修改索引。下面是一些示例:
如果要添加一个新的索引,可以使用以下语法:
```sql
ALTER TABLE table_name ADD INDEX index_name (column1, column2, ...);
```
如果要删除一个索引,可以使用以下语法:
```sql
ALTER TABLE table_name DROP INDEX index_name;
```
如果要修改现有的索引,可以使用以下语法:
```sql
ALTER TABLE table_name DROP INDEX index_name,
ADD INDEX index_name (column1, column2, ...);
```
请将`table_name`替换为你想要修改索引的表名,将`index_name`替换为你想要添加、删除或修改的索引名称,将`column1, column2, ...`替换为索引所涉及的列名。
记得在执行这些语句之前,最好先备份你的数据。
mysql 修改索引名称
在MySQL中修改索引名称可以通过删除原索引,再创建一个同名的索引来实现。可以使用DROP INDEX语句或ALTER TABLE语句来删除索引。例如,要删除表tb_stu_info2中名称为id的索引,可以使用以下SQL语句:
```
ALTER TABLE tb_stu_info2
DROP INDEX id;
```
执行该语句后,可以使用SHOW CREATE TABLE语句来验证索引是否已成功删除。例如,执行以下SQL语句:
```
SHOW CREATE TABLE tb_stu_info2\G
```
执行结果中将不再包含名称为id的索引。然后,可以根据需要使用CREATE INDEX语句来创建一个新的同名索引。
#### 引用[.reference_title]
- *1* *2* [11、修改和删除索引(DROP INDEX)](https://blog.csdn.net/weixin_44234912/article/details/108999422)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^control,239^v3^insert_chatgpt"}} ] [.reference_item]
- *3* [MySQL数据库——MySQL修改和删除索引(DROP INDEX)](https://blog.csdn.net/Itmastergo/article/details/130500798)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^control,239^v3^insert_chatgpt"}} ] [.reference_item]
[ .reference_list ]
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![](https://img-home.csdnimg.cn/images/20210720083646.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)